A second objective compared outcomes of tongue suspension as part of a multilevel approach to OSA surgery to genioglossus advancement (GA) with uvulopalatopharyngoplasty (UPPP), and to genioglossus advancement with hyoid suspension (GAHM) with UPPP.</p> </sec> <sec id="lary24187-sec-0002" sec-type="section"> <title>Study Design</title> <p>Systematic review.</p> </sec> <sec id="lary24187-sec-0003" sec-type="section"> <title>Methods</title> <p>The PubMed database was queried for English‐language studies published after 1997 to create four cohorts: tongue suspension alone, tongue suspension with UPPP, GA + UPPP, and GAHM with UPPP. Chi‐squared test was used to compare outcomes between cohorts.</p> </sec> <sec id="lary24187-sec-0004" sec-type="section"> <title>Results</title> <p>Twenty‐seven studies were included, broken down into cohorts based on our selection criteria. Six studies qualified for the tongue suspension‐alone group with a surgical success rate of 36.6%. Eight studies qualified for our cohort of tongue suspension with UPPP with a surgical success rate of 62.3%. Eighteen studies qualified for our remaining two cohorts: GA + UPPP, and GAHM + UPPP. Their surgical success rates were both 61.1%. A chi‐squared test to compare surgical outcomes showed that there was no difference between tongue suspension with UPPP, GA + UPPP, and GAHM + UPPP.</p> </sec> <sec id="lary24187-sec-0005" sec-type="section"> <title>Conclusion</title> <p>Tongue suspension is effective and safe as part of a multilevel surgical approach for patients with OSA. As a stand‐alone procedure, its success rate is 36.6%, comparable to UPPP procedures for OSA success rates across the board. Tongue suspension should be considered in patients with OSA who demonstrate tongue base obstruction.</p> </sec> <sec id="lary24187-sec-0006" sec-type="section"> <title>Level of Evidence</title> <p>4. <italic>Laryngoscope</italic>, 124:329–336, 2014</p> </sec> </abstract> … (more)
